This episode covers the Dateline episode "The Widow of Woodland Hills," featuring guests Blaine Alexander and Josh Mankiewicz. Key topics include the murder of hairstylist Fabio Cimentelli, the investigation into his death, and the subsequent trial of his wife Monica and her lover Robert Baker.
Josh Mankiewicz discusses the shocking details surrounding Fabio's murder, including the discovery of an affair that led to the crime. He highlights the emotional impact on Fabio's family and the complexities of the relationships involved.
The episode features insights into the investigative process, including the role of the LAPD's Special Investigation Section and the use of undercover operations. Mankiewicz shares anecdotes about the trial, the testimonies, and the dynamics between the key players.
Listeners hear about the aftermath of the verdict, the reactions from both families, and the ongoing support from Fabio's daughters for their mother, despite the evidence against her. The episode concludes with a discussion of audience questions and comments.
